Understanding the EB5 Visa Program

While several immigration alternatives exist for people looking for to relocate to the USA, the EB5 Visa Program attracts attention as an unique pathway for financiers. Developed to promote the U.S. economy, this program permits international nationals to acquire irreversible residency by investing a minimum of $1 million, or $500,000 in targeted work areas. Investors must protect or produce at the very least ten full time jobs for U.S. employees with their investment in a brand-new business. The EB5 Visa not just gives a path to U.S. citizenship however additionally uses financiers the opportunity to involve in different organization endeavors. This program appeals particularly to those wanting to diversify their properties while adding to the economic development of the United States.

Regional Centers vs. Direct Financial investment

When taking into consideration the EB5 visa, UK citizens encounter an option in between investing via regional centers or choosing for straight financial investment. Each alternative features unique financial investment frameworks, varying work creation requirements, and differing degrees of threat evaluation - EB5 Visa. Understanding these distinctions is necessary for making an informed decision that straightens with individual financial investment objectives

Investment Structure Differences

While both Regional Centers and Direct Investment stand for pathways for acquiring an EB5 visa, they differ significantly in structure and needs. Regional Centers are organizations marked by the United States Citizenship and Migration Provider (USCIS) that pool investments from numerous capitalists right into larger tasks. This structure permits for an extra varied danger and frequently includes less straight management from the investor. Conversely, Direct Investment needs a capitalist to place their funds right into a specific business and take an active function in its administration (EB5 Visa For UK Citizens). This direct approach typically requires more hands-on involvement and a complete understanding of the service landscape. Each option presents one-of-a-kind obstacles and benefits, influencing the capitalist's choice based on personal preferences and financial investment objectives

Risk Evaluation Considerations

Just how do risk aspects vary between Regional Centers and Direct Financial investment alternatives in the EB5 visa program? Regional Centers typically provide a diversified financial investment strategy, pooling funds from multiple financiers into larger jobs, which can mitigate private threat. Nevertheless, the success of these centers depends on their monitoring and job selection, presenting possible challenges if improperly taken care of. Conversely, Direct Financial investment allows investors to maintain higher control over their funds by spending directly in a business. While this alternative may give a clearer understanding of investment procedures, it additionally carries greater threats due to the private company's performance and market volatility. Eventually, investors should consider the advantages of control versus the integral risks of straight participation versus the cumulative protection of Regional Centers.
